Aug. 5, 2010
FRESNO, Calif. - On a warm, summer Thursday afternoon, members of the Fresno State volleyball tespent time at River Park while meeting their fans, signing autograph cards and taking photos.

The showcase was the final public event before `Dogs arrive back on campus Monday, Aug. 9 for the start of camp. Classes at Fresno State begin on Aug. 23.
"The buzz amongst our staff and players is intoxicating," head coach Lauren Netherby-Sewell added of her excitement for the start of the season. "We're chomping at the bit to get in the gym and continue our preparation for conference play. The curiosity of the impact our new blood will have on this team is eating at me. It's an exciting time."
The resurgence of the program garnered notice earlier this week with the selection of the Bulldogs to finish third during the upcoming 2010 season in the Western Athletic Conference Preseason Coaches' Poll, which marks the highest predicted finish in the poll since 2004.
Throughout the summer, the Bulldogs have been playing in weekend double tournaments on a variety of surfaces, including grass and sand aside from the regular indoor court.
Fresno State returns a talented roster that advanced to the semifinals of the 2009 WAC Tournament. The Bulldogs feature four seniors in Lauren Berger, Kelly Mason, Meghan Moses and Kasey Van Grouw for head coach Lauren Netherby-Sewell's third season guiding the Fresno State program.
The Bulldog volleyball team opens the 2010 season by hosting the Fresno State Classic on Aug. 27-28. The two-day tournament will welcome UC Riverside, Santa Clara and No. 18 Oregon to the Save Mart Center. The annual crosstown exhibition with Fresno Pacific will take place Sept. 8 at the Save Mart Center, followed by the Fresno State Invitational Sept. 17-18.
Netherby-Sewell's program was also recently recognized by the American Volleyball Coaches Association as the only Western Athletic Conference volleyball team to earn the AVCA Team Academic Award for the 2009-10 season for averaging at least a 3.30 grade point average.
